Reissues (CDs / Vinyl)

Artist: Title: Label:
Paul Carrack “Love Songs” (two-CD, 38-track collection of songs previously only available on download/streaming sites; Amazon UK) (Carrack UK)
Herb Ellis “The Early Years” (eight albums on four CDs) (Enlightenment)
Helen Forrest “The Helen Forrest Hits Collection 1938-46” (two CDs, 50 songs, including “Time Waits for No One”; Hear here) (Acrobat)
Ahmad Jamal “‘At The Pershing’ and Other Live Recordings 1958-59” (three CDs, 57 songs) (Acrobat)
The Jazz Messengers “Classic Albums 1956-1963” (eight original albums on four CDs) (Enlightenment)
Killing Joke “The Unperverted Pantomime” (1983 collection of live recordings and radio sessions; Transparent Purple Vinyl) (Cadiz Music)
Metal Church “From the Vault” (14 previously unreleased tracks from the Mike Howe era; Vinyl) (Rat Pak)
Joni Mitchell & James Taylor “Paris Theatre 1970: The Classic London Broadcast” (18-song set taped by the BBC and broadcast as one of John Peel’s Sunday Shows) (All Access)
Sun Ra “Celestial Love” (recordings cut in September 1982 at New York’s Variety Studios; Vinyl; Download) (Modern Harmonic)
Andy Russell “The Andy Russell Collection 1944-49” (two CDs, 50 songs) (Acrobat)
Bobby Rydell “The Singles & Albums Collection 1959-62” (two CDs, 60 songs) (Acrobat)
Allan Sherman “There Is Nothing Like a Lox: The Lost Song Parodies of Alan Sherman” (13 tracks; Download) (Liberation Hall)
Cat Stevens “Back To Earth (Super Deluxe Box)” (1978 album; remastered; box set contains five CDs, two vinyl LPs and one Blu-ray; See here; Read here; Amazon UK; On Tour; Merch) (Cat-O-Log / BMG Rights Management)
T. Rex “Electric Warrior [Hybrid SACD]” (1971 album, featuring “Bang a Gong [Get It On],” “Jeepster” and “Life’s a Gas”; remastered, containing a “Red Book” CD Layer which is playable on most conventional CD players) (Mobile Fidelity)
Various artists “Motown: The Early Years 1959-62” (80 songs on three CDs) (Acrobat)
Sheb Wooley “The Sheb Wooley Collection 1946-62” (two-CD, 60-song set features A and B sides from his singles on the Bullet, Blue Bonnet and MGM labels) (Acrobat)
